Grounds Of Shaw House Church Road Shaw Newbury

Lucombe oak AEL proposed works: crown lift to 2.5 metres to discourage children swinging and hanging from the lowest branches, and to carry out a crown reduction of 20% with branch length reduction of 2-2.5m. Current height is 15m and spread 17m. The proposed works would bring crown down to height of 13m and the spread to 15m. The tree is declining in health due to extensive basal and stem decay on the north side of the tree due in part to the ongoing presence of fruiting body pathogen, probably Meripilus giganteus. The tree is in a busy part of the Shaw House gardens and a path runs within the canopy of the tree. Lucombe oak AEZ proposed works: crown lift to 2.5 metres to discourage children swinging and hanging from the lowest branches, a children's play ground has just been built 10 metres away from the tree and it is foreseeable that they will swing from the lowest branches unless we crown lift them.
